Title: Low Price Items Post by HellasHaggis on 01/21/06 at 16:03:44 Hi Dieter My compliments to you on the script, it is brilliant. Please can you tell me how I might be able to configure the 'Low price items' so as to input a price that is considered low for when the search is activated by clicking on the 'Low Price Item' link? Again my thanksin advance. Sincerely HH |
Title: Re: Low Price Items Post by Dieter Werner on 01/21/06 at 16:17:22 There is nothing to configure ... every item that is having a starting price of $1.00 is a 'Low Price' item; that's hard coded. See sub disp_list Code:
